Source: Final Fantasy VIII Total Cost: 220 USD about Time Consumed: 50 + hours Why I made it: Well, for a while now I've had this fabric which I absolutely HAD to make into a Rinoa outfit. Then .. Well long story short… the glorious Pixiekitty was going to wear her new sorceressy costume of amazingness at Otakon and I wanted to do more cosplay with her. After much deliberation I finally decided to go ahead and do it. I didn't used to like her character too much, but as I made the costume she grew on me. And look I can actually smile and be in character!!! How I made it: This costume was simple yet difficult. The shorts were existing biker shorts which I hand basted zippers onto then machine stitched. The fabric was a bit more complicated for the duster. I found some lovely light light blue wide rib knit fabric and then dyed it twice to get it to the right shade. The fabric was then cut into the duster and the sleeves and serged together. . . . That's where I realized I couldn't machine hem the sides.. so that's all hand stitched in the front and the arms there.. and then the bottom is serged. The skirt was an interesting blue cotton print I found. I draped the pattern myself then sewed and added silver buttons. The dusterwings are hand painted onto the back. Oh yes, and the wings. I did some research first to try and figure out the structure on them. I used tom turkey feathers and flat turkey feathers, copper and hot glue and fabric for them. Likes: I just love this costume. It's comfortable, the wings are gorgeous, and the wig is human hair.. yay! Also in some of the pictures it looked like my eyes turned brown.. that too is cool! Dislikes: I don't like mosquito bites.
